Concern for the Corinthian Church
11 I have become (A)foolish; you yourselves compelled me. For I ought to have been commended by you, for (B)in no respect was I inferior to the [a]most-eminent apostles, even if (C)I am nothing. 12 The [b](D)signs [c]of a true apostle were worked out among you with all perseverance, by [d]signs and wonders and [e]miracles. 13 For in what respect were you treated as less than the rest of the churches, except that (E)I myself did not become a burden to you? [f]Forgive me (F)this wrong!

11 I’ve become a fool! You made me do it. Actually, I should have been commended by you. I’m not inferior to the super-apostles in any way, even though I’m a nonentity. 12 The signs of an apostle were performed among you with continuous endurance through signs, wonders, and miracles. 13 How were you treated worse than the other churches, except that I myself wasn’t a financial burden on you? Forgive me for this wrong!
